Transaction 402687739964acb093a1d5f27971fe28c45660d27601d5d6c5b926e56da0f1ac
1 Input
1 Output
-
402687739964acb093a1d5f27971fe28c45660d27601d5d6c5b926e56da0f1ac:0
- value
- 645431
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a78952b3398d337d9635136227f73332ca4e688d OP_EQUAL
- address
- 3GxsGxAsrYbTi3QRACCHjn2yMjiN2RxUT2